/**
******************************************************************************
* Xenia : Xbox 360 Emulator Research Project *
******************************************************************************
* Copyright 2013 Ben Vanik. All rights reserved. *
* Released under the BSD license - see LICENSE in the root for more details. *
******************************************************************************
*/
#include <alloy/runtime/debugger.h>
#include <alloy/mutex.h>
#include <alloy/runtime/runtime.h>
using namespace alloy;
using namespace alloy::runtime;
Breakpoint::Breakpoint(Type type, uint64_t address) :
type_(type), address_(address) {
}
Breakpoint::~Breakpoint() {
}
Debugger::Debugger(Runtime* runtime) :
runtime_(runtime) {
breakpoints_lock_ = AllocMutex();
}
Debugger::~Debugger() {
FreeMutex(breakpoints_lock_);
}
int Debugger::AddBreakpoint(Breakpoint* breakpoint) {
// Add to breakpoints map.
LockMutex(breakpoints_lock_);
breakpoints_.insert(
std::pair<uint64_t, Breakpoint*>(breakpoint->address(), breakpoint));
UnlockMutex(breakpoints_lock_);
// Find all functions that contain the breakpoint address.
auto fns = runtime_->FindFunctionsWithAddress(breakpoint->address());
// Add.
for (auto it = fns.begin(); it != fns.end(); ++it) {
Function* fn = *it;
if (fn->AddBreakpoint(breakpoint)) {
return 1;
}
}
return 0;
}
int Debugger::RemoveBreakpoint(Breakpoint* breakpoint) {
// Remove from breakpoint map.
LockMutex(breakpoints_lock_);
auto range = breakpoints_.equal_range(breakpoint->address());
if (range.first == range.second) {
UnlockMutex(breakpoints_lock_);
return 1;
}
bool found = false;
for (auto it = range.first; it != range.second; ++it) {
if (it->second == breakpoint) {
breakpoints_.erase(it);
found = true;
break;
}
}
UnlockMutex(breakpoints_lock_);
if (!found) {
return 1;
}
// Find all functions that have the breakpoint set.
auto fns = runtime_->FindFunctionsWithAddress(breakpoint->address());
// Remove.
for (auto it = fns.begin(); it != fns.end(); ++it) {
Function* fn = *it;
fn->RemoveBreakpoint(breakpoint);
}
return 0;
}
void Debugger::FindBreakpoints(
uint64_t address, std::vector<Breakpoint*>& out_breakpoints) {
out_breakpoints.clear();
LockMutex(breakpoints_lock_);
auto range = breakpoints_.equal_range(address);
if (range.first == range.second) {
UnlockMutex(breakpoints_lock_);
return;
}
for (auto it = range.first; it != range.second; ++it) {
Breakpoint* breakpoint = it->second;
out_breakpoints.push_back(breakpoint);
}
UnlockMutex(breakpoints_lock_);
}
void Debugger::OnFunctionDefined(FunctionInfo* symbol_info,
Function* function) {
// Man, I'd love not to take this lock.
std::vector<Breakpoint*> breakpoints;
LockMutex(breakpoints_lock_);
for (uint64_t address = symbol_info->address();
address <= symbol_info->end_address(); address += 4) {
auto range = breakpoints_.equal_range(address);
if (range.first == range.second) {
continue;
}
for (auto it = range.first; it != range.second; ++it) {
Breakpoint* breakpoint = it->second;
breakpoints.push_back(breakpoint);
}
}
UnlockMutex(breakpoints_lock_);
if (breakpoints.size()) {
// Breakpoints to add!
for (auto it = breakpoints.begin(); it != breakpoints.end(); ++it) {
function->AddBreakpoint(*it);
}
}
}
